Snippet
Transparent and low-density methylsilsesquioxane (MSQ, CH3SiO1. 5) aerogels can be obtained solely from methyltrimethoxysilane (MTMS) by a one-pot two-step process under the co-presence of surfactant. In the present study, we have systematically investigated the …
